Diane is a lovely host, offered great dining recommendations and served a delicious breakfast. The home, however, was not to our liking. There is a lot of clutter throughout, such that the living room of the home was not usable by guests, and our room was too cluttered with antiques/nick knacks to be able to place our items on any surfaces- it was too cluttered to be relaxing and surely there is not enough time in the day to dust all of the hundreds (thousands?) of nick knacks in the room or throughout the house . The kitchen disarray, including dirty dishes left in the sink, was disconcerting. There are no locks on the doors to each guest room, and Diane entered our room when we were away from the house to retrieve our registration form. For these reasons, despite the lovely innkeeper and outdoor area (koi pond), we would not stay here again.
